Be Just You

Scared to be alone,
frightened to be so close
something too strange that you haven’t known before--
so different that tears stream; down your face.

Should you ever reach that place
would you ever be afraid
would you ever be so calm
would you ever be just you?
be just you?

Always a reason to go
is never a reason to leave.
Something to keep you down
with your eyes on above.
Never a reason to stay
is always a reason come.
Nothing to keep you up
with your eyes on the ground.

Should you ever reach that place
would you ever be afraid
would you ever be so calm
would you ever be just you?
be just you?

The hand holds yours
closer than you’ve felt
something different than before
‘cause it’s not what happened then.

Truth to tell that comfort’s lost
truth to say that it’s so close
truth to think about it all
truth to grab that hand and fall.

Should you ever reach that place
would you ever be afraid
would you ever be so calm
would you ever be just you?
be just you?
Would you ever be just you?
be… just you?
